About Katarzyna Nowak
Katarzyna Nowak is a scholar working on Aging, Plant Science and Molecular Biology, having authored 24 papers that have together received 631 indexed citations. Recurring topics across this work include Plant tissue culture and regeneration (19 papers), Plant Molecular Biology Research (17 papers) and Plant Reproductive Biology (8 papers). The work is most often cited by research in Aging (23 citations), Plant Science (485 citations) and Molecular Biology (507 citations). Katarzyna Nowak has collaborated with scholars based in Poland, Switzerland and United Kingdom. Frequent co-authors include Małgorzata D. Gaj, Barbara Wójcikowska, Bernd Mueller‐Roeber, Salma Balazadeh, Anna M. Wójcik, Hugo Stocker, Marian Kupka, Karolina Stępień, Mateusz Mołoń and Ernst Hafen. Their work appears in journals such as PLoS ONE, International Journal of Molecular Sciences and PLoS Genetics.
